Police arrested an Island Park man on Thursday after he allegedly walked into a Dairy Barn, took out a knife and demanded money from a store employee.
Police said Steven Conde, 40, entered the store on 2735 Oceanside Rd., on June 3 at 1:46 p.m., and made off with an unknown amount of cash. He fled the scene in his 1993 Oldsmobile.
Shortly after, police said a plain clothes Rockville Centre police officer observed Conde in his vehicle driving north on North Long Beach Road. The police officer was made aware of the vehicle following a robbery notification.
Conde was placed under arrest and charged with first-degree robbery and third-degree criminal possession of a weapon. He was arraigned at First District Court in Hempstead on June 4.
